Decursinol

CAS No. 23458-02-8

Decursinol( —— )

Catalog No. M21544 CAS No. 23458-02-8

Decursinol is isolated from the roots of Angelica Gigas with an antinociceptive effect. It also has anti-tumor and anti-metastasis activity.

Chemical Information

  • CAS Number
    23458-02-8
  • Formula Weight
    246.26
  • Molecular Formula
    C14H14O4
  • Purity
    >98% (HPLC)
  • Solubility
    DMSO:25 mg/mL (115.19 mM)
  • SMILES
    CC1(C)Oc2cc(OC(C=C3)=O)c3cc2C[C@@H]1O
